Copasa and Médio Piracicaba mayors discuss new sanitation model
Mayors from the Médio Rio Piracicaba microregion met with representatives from the Companhia de Saneamento de Minas Gerais (Copasa) to discuss a new contractual model for sanitation services. The meeting, organized by the Association of Municipalities of the Médio Rio Piracicaba (Amepi), aimed to clarify the terms of a proposed municipal block for service adhesion.
During the session, which included Copasa's CEO Marília Carvalho de Melo, local leaders addressed technical, legal, operational, financial, and regulatory aspects of the new proposal. Discussions focused on the specific obligations of both the municipalities and the sanitation company, as well as the rules for joining the collective block.
Augusto Henrique, the mayor of Rio Piracicaba and president of Amepi, emphasized the need for transparency and direct dialogue. He stated that the association seeks to ensure municipal managers have clear information and security before making decisions regarding essential services like water supply and sewage treatment.
